About the role

  • Lead the end-to-end design of AI-powered experiences across multiple product lines, including agentic workflows, generative interactions, and human-in-the-loop systems
  • Define and evangelize UX strategy across complex problem spaces, setting design direction that influences product roadmaps and strategic priorities
  • Serve as a thought leader in the design of useful, usable, and desirable AI-powered products in a team environment
  • Chart a course for yourself and others in ambiguous situations, leading strategic thinking across teams and mentoring designers
  • Contribute to and shape internal design standards for AI patterns, design guidelines, evaluation criteria, and UX quality benchmarks
  • Translate model behaviors, data inputs, and system limitations into coherent UX patterns that drive user trust and product adoption at scale
  • Prototype with real AI/LLM models to evaluate user prompts, improve model responses, and inform product direction
  • Map and design collaboration patterns between users and AI – defining when AI acts autonomously, when humans take control, and how handoffs occur
  • Create clear interaction flows that incorporate transparency moments, safety guardrails, override options, and recovery states

Requirements

  • Extensive design experience creating simple solutions for complex challenges
  • Experience designing with AI or LLM technologies, including prompt design, generative UX, and evaluating model output quality
  • Strong portfolio of work that illustrates your process, your level of craft, and the measurable results you have driven, with demonstrated end-to-end ownership of complex workflows
  • Deep understanding of model behaviors and limitations—hallucinations, confidence levels, deterministic vs. probabilistic output, and data quality impacts
  • Experience working across teams to synthesize feedback and input from product management, engineering, data science, and marketing
  • Strong interaction design skills with the ability to simplify ambiguous AI behaviors into predictable, user-centered experiences
  • Ability to prototype using tools such as v0, Figma Make, Cursor, Python notebooks, model sandboxes, or no-code AI orchestration tools
  • Hands-on experience planning and executing end-to-end user research—defining objectives, recruiting participants, moderating studies, synthesizing insights, and translating findings into roadmap and design decisions
